Join Lara Croft on her first great tomb raiding expedition as she seeks to discover the secret of immortality. Featuring high-octane action set in the most beautiful and hostile environments on earth, Rise of the Tomb Raider delivers cinematic survival action-adventure.

Gameplay Mechanics
Expand for full analysis
86
Rise of the Tomb Raider dazzles with polished platforming, immersive exploration, and tactical combat, blending action, stealth, and puzzles into a rich, Metroidvania-style world. While its crafting systems and varied playstyles earn praise, tedious resource gathering, uneven combat mechanics, and a linear design tarnish the experience. Despite flaws, it’s hailed as a bold, engaging evolution of the series—worth playing for its ambition, if not perfection.

Music and Sound Design
Expand for full analysis
82
Critics hailed Rise of the Tomb Raider’s sound design as immersive and atmospheric, with dynamic orchestral scores and emotional depth enhancing its adventurous tone. Camilla Luddington’s vocal performance stood out, while a mystical and action-oriented mix elevated immersion. However, some noted UI interruptions, uneven voice acting for supporting characters, overbearing background music in cutscenes, and minor technical issues like subtitling flaws. Despite these critiques, the audio remained a standout pillar of the game’s success.

Technical Performance
Expand for full analysis
77
Rise of the Tomb Raider nails stability on Xbox One with 30fps smoothness but suffers frame drops and glitches; PC shines with scalable graphics and 60fps, though optimization hiccups linger. Both platforms deliver solid performance despite quirks, making it a polished yet imperfect experience.
